Chartiers Valley Soccer Association
The Chartiers Valley Soccer Association (CVSA) is a nonprofit organization dedicated to promoting youth soccer in the Chartiers Valley School District area of Pennsylvania. As a member of Pennsylvania West State Soccer Association (PA West Soccer), CVSA adheres to the ethical rules set forth by this governing body for soccer in Western Pennsylvania[1][2].
Mission and Activities
-
Mission: The mission of CVSA is to provide a quality soccer program focused on developing high-quality youth soccer players, promoting physical fitness, teamwork, and fun at a competitive level[1].
-
Programs: CVSA offers both Community In-House Soccer and Travel Soccer programs. The Community In-House program is designed for entry-level players, focusing on having fun while developing foundational soccer skills. It is structured around two seasons: Fall and Spring. Each season typically includes one weeknight practice and one Saturday game, with all games hosted locally[2].
Program Element Description Age Range 4 to 18 years old Cost Low, at $85 per season Practice and Games 1 weeknight practice, 1 Saturday game per week Focus Entry-level skills development and enjoyment -
Volunteer Opportunities: CVSA actively encourages parental involvement through volunteer coaching. Volunteers must complete background checks and SafeSport training[2].
Financial Overview
CVSA operates primarily on revenues from program services, with minimal income from fundraising activities[3][5]. As a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ization, donations to CVSA are tax-deductible, though the organization has historically reported no contributions in its financial statements[3][5].
Fields and Facilities
CVSA utilizes fields at Collier Park and Chartiers Valley Intermediate and High Schools for its soccer programs[2].
Governance
CVSA is led by a board of directors, which includes positions like President, Vice President, Treasurer, Secretary, and various directors. None of the key employees or officers receive compensation for their roles[3][5].
